What is GOV.UK Template?›
GOV.UK Template is a design framework provided by the UK government to help maintain visual consistency across all government websites and digital services. It includes standard design patterns, styles, and HTML templates for creating user interfaces that meet accessibility and usability standards.
Who can use GOV.UK Template?›
GOV.UK Template is primarily intended for government departments, local authorities, and public bodies within the United Kingdom. Developers and designers working on government-related projects can use these templates to maintain a consistent user interface and accessibility standards.
Does GOV.UK Template require specific technical skills?›
Using GOV.UK Template requires basic knowledge of HTML, CSS, and JavaScript, as the templates consist of these web development languages. Developers with experience in web development will find it relatively easy to implement and customize the GOV.UK Template according to their project requirements.
Is the GOV.UK Template compatible with different devices and browsers?›
Yes, the GOV.UK Template is designed to be responsive and compatible with various devices, including desktop computers, laptops, tablets, and mobile phones. It also ensures cross-browser compatibility with modern browsers such as Google Chrome, Mozilla Firefox, Safari, and Microsoft Edge.
How can I access GOV.UK Template resources and documentation?›
GOV.UK Template resources and documentation can be accessed through the official website at https://design-system.service.gov.uk/. The website provides extensive documentation, including design principles, patterns, components, and guidance on how to implement and customize the templates effectively.
